The size of Ripplebrook is approximately 30.9 square kilometres. The population of Ripplebrook in 2016 was 221 people. By 2021 the population was 268 showing a population growth of 21.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ripplebrook is 10-19 years. Households in Ripplebrook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ripplebrook work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 76.10% of the homes in Ripplebrook were owner-occupied compared with 77.00% in 2016.
